首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>通过Bower in -libsass环境安装基金会-图标字体

通过Bower in -libsass环境安装基金会-图标字体
EN

Stack Overflow用户
提问于 2014-12-22 10:17:03
回答 1查看 673关注 0票数 0

我使用的是基金会5-基础-libsass-模板。使用bower,我使用以下命令"bower install foundation-icons --save"添加了基础图标。此命令下载基金会图标包并将其保存到bower_components文件夹并修改我的bower.json文件。

代码语言:javascript
复制
{
  "name": "foundation-libsass-template",
  "dependencies": {
    "foundation": "zurb/bower-foundation",
    "foundation-icon-fonts": "zurb/foundation-icon-fonts"
  }
}

问题:当我将@import "foundation-icon-fonts";添加到app.scss文件时,Grunt返回一个错误,因为它找不到该文件:

警告: C:/Users/Chris/Websites/example.com/lp/new/scss/app.scss:3:文件导入未找到或不可读:“基础图标-字体”

问题1:我需要修改Grunt.js文件才能包含这个库吗?如果是的话,能否有人提供一个例子?谢谢。

EN

回答 1

Stack Overflow用户

发布于 2014-12-22 14:52:02

嗯,我不使用这个包,但是@import CSS指令(和Sass版本)需要一个正确的导入路径。所以,既然您使用这个作为Bower模块,我想您需要这样的东西:

代码语言:javascript
复制
@import "bower_components/foundation-icons/path-to-styles.css";

但是,当我在我的系统上安装Bower包时,它看起来有多个目录,其中有字体和样式表:

代码语言:javascript
复制
.bower.json
foundation_icons_accessibility/
foundation_icons_general/
foundation_icons_general_enclosed/
foundation_icons_social/
.gitignore
MIT-LICENSE.txt
README.markdown

所以你可能需要指定目录?

代码语言:javascript
复制
@import "bower_components/path-to-foundation/foundation_icons_general/sass/general_foundicons.css";
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/27600631

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档